Hack Idea: A Traveling Dip Pen
Dip pens are priceless when it comes to swatching inks, enabling the user to quickly and completely clean the nib between ink changes. There’s no other way to test several inks in a row. Pen Review: Musgrave Duets
Review by Tina Koyama Musgrave Pencil Co. of Shelbyville, Tennessee, is one of very few remaining pencil manufacturers in the US. Operating since 1916, it’s still family-owned.
